A counterpoint from the past
Fighting Whites - Wikipedia
quote:
The Fighting Whites (alternatively identified as Fightin' Whites, Fighting Whities, or Fightin' Whities) were an intramural basketball team formed at the University of Northern Colorado in 2002 and named in response to the Native American mascot controversy.
...
The intramural team, which included players of Native American, white, Latino, African American, and middle eastern ancestry, adopted the name "Fighting Whites", with an accompanying logo of a stereotypical "white man" in a suit, ...
